mysql创建database

pythondaimakaiyuan

温馨提示:这篇文章已超过230天没有更新,请注意相关的内容是否还可用!

mysql创建database

在MySQL中创建数据库是一项非常基础的操作,它允许我们在数据库管理系统中创建一个新的数据库,以便在其中存储和管理数据。下面是创建数据库的步骤及示例代码:

我们需要使用CREATE DATABASE语句来创建数据库。CREATE DATABASE语句后面跟着数据库的名称,用于指定要创建的数据库的名称。例如,我们可以使用以下代码创建一个名为"mydatabase"的数据库:

CREATE DATABASE mydatabase;

在执行上述代码后,MySQL将创建一个名为"mydatabase"的空数据库。我们可以使用该数据库来存储和管理数据。

我们还可以使用IF NOT EXISTS来避免在已存在同名数据库时出现错误。例如,以下代码将创建一个名为"mydatabase"的数据库,但仅在该名称的数据库尚不存在时才执行创建操作:

CREATE DATABASE IF NOT EXISTS mydatabase;

这样,即使我们多次执行上述代码,只有第一次执行时会创建数据库,后续执行将不会产生任何影响。

我们还可以在创建数据库时指定一些可选参数,例如字符集和校对规则。字符集用于指定数据库中存储的文本数据的编码方式,校对规则用于指定对文本数据进行排序和比较时的规则。以下代码示例演示了如何在创建数据库时指定字符集和校对规则:

CREATE DATABASE mydatabase

CHARACTER SET utf8mb4

COLLATE utf8mb4_unicode_ci;

在上述代码中,我们使用CHARACTER SET关键字指定了字符集为"utf8mb4",COLLATE关键字指定了校对规则为"utf8mb4_unicode_ci"。这将确保数据库中的文本数据以正确的编码方式存储,并在排序和比较时按照指定的规则进行。

需要注意的是,创建数据库的操作通常需要具备足够的权限。在某些情况下,可能需要使用管理员或超级用户账户来执行该操作。

创建数据库是一个基础且重要的操作,我们可以使用CREATE DATABASE语句来创建一个新的数据库,并可以通过指定可选参数来进一步定制数据库的属性。在实际应用中,我们还可以结合其他相关知识,如数据库表的创建和数据的插入等,来完善数据库的设计和使用。

文章版权声明:除非注明,否则均为莫宇前端原创文章,转载或复制请以超链接形式并注明出处。

取消
微信二维码
微信二维码
支付宝二维码